Sponsor/Award: CROHN'S & COLITIS FOUNDATION CANADA - INNOVATIONS IN IBD RESEARCH - INNOVATIONS GRANT - 2017 WINTER COMPETITION

Grant Amount: $50K FOR UP TO ONE YEAR
Deadline: Dean's: Contact your Faculty Research Office for deadline details.
Internal: Jan 13, 2017
Sponsor's: Jan 20, 2017

Subject Areas: irritable bowel syndrome
Description:

Crohn's and Colitis Canada invites applications for funding novel or innovative approaches to inflammatory bowel disease (IBD) research. "Innovations in IBD" is intended to stimulate and support IBD related research which may not be encompassed within the boundaries of other research funders.

This competition will fund innovative projects deemed scientifically excellent, will refine hypotheses and/or produce preliminary data that will help seed larger projects and have the potential to improve diagnosis, therapy or prevention of IBD. Please review the sponsor's guidelines for full details.

Application Details:

The Principal Investigator can be a postdoctoral fellow or someone with a faculty or equivalent appointment at the institution. There can be only one Principal Investigator for each proposal. The applicant institution must be a nonprofit, charitable institution, such as a university, hospital or research organization. Applications are accepted from institutions within Canada only.
